#4e68f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e68fa is composed of 30.6% red, 40.8%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.8% cyan, 58.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 230.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 64.3%. #4e68fa color hex could be obtained by blending #9cd0ff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#4e68f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e68fa has RGB values of R:78, G:104,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5138682.

Shades and Tints of #4e68fa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00020e is the darkest color, while #fafaff is the lightest one.
